Abstract:
                                      The chemical constituents in the seeds of 
Trichosanthes rubriflos were isolated and purified by silica gel column chromatography, Sephadex LH-20 column chromatography, high performance liquid chromatography and other separation methods. The structures were characterized by various spectroscopic. Four compounds identified as 7,24-dioxo-10α-cucurbita-5,25-dien-3
β-ol (  
1  ), cucurbita-5,25-diene-3
β,24-diol (  
2  ), (
E)-11-methoxy-11-oxoundec-2-enoic acid (  
3  ), (12
S,13
S,
Z)-12-hydroxyoctadec-9-en-13-olide (  
4  ). Compound   
1   and   
2   are new compounds and compound   
3   is a new natural compound, while compound   
4   was isolated from 
Trichosanthes for the first time.
